Denver Broncos Gear Up For NFL Draft 2024

The Denver Broncos, on the lookout for a long-term quarterback solution, are setting their sights on the heart of the college football calendar. With the current rosters featuring Jarrett Stidham and Ben DiNucci, neither of whom satisfy their need for a long-term solution, the team is keen to bring in fresh talent from the 2024 NFL Draft.

Rattler Marks as a Promising Draft Prospect

This year in the NFL season, the Reece’s Senior Bowl serves as the perfect opportunity for supporters to scout for potential picks. Among the aspirants that have attracted attention is former reality TV star and current South Carolina representative, Spencer Rattler.

According to a report by Erick Trickel for SI.com, Rattler, along with Michael Pratt from Tulane, are the standout prospects from the American roster. Rattler’s skills could make him a reliable NFL starter, given his impressive record of 10,807 passing yards, 68.5% completion, 77 touchdowns, and 32 interceptions through 48 games in five college football seasons.

However, concerns hover around Rattler regarding his attitude and character which have caused him controversy over the years. The Senior Bowl not only provides a platform for Rattler to showcase his on-field prowess, but also an opportunity to address these concerns in front of NFL general managers.

The Netflix Satellite Fame

Rattler, before his college career, also featured in the Netflix docuseries “QB1: Beyond the Lights”. The show captured his journey at Pinnacle High School in Phoenix, Arizona, where he reached the highly rated prospect status. Rattler broke the all-time state passing record with 10,489 yards, becoming the No. 1 dual-threat quarterback and the No. 29 prospect overall in 2019 according to ESPN’s college football recruiting rankings.

Other QB Picks for Broncos

While Rattler has been the focus, other quarterbacks present at the Senior Bowl also demand attention for their potential as draft prospects.

Joe Milton III from Tennessee and Bradley Carter from South Alabama are among the shortlisted picks. Meanwhile, Pratt of Tulane boasts an impressive record of 90 touchdowns to 26 interceptions, piquing interest among the Broncos’ trainers and staff.

Rounding out Broncos’ watchlist from the National Team roster are Oregon’s Bo Nix, Notre Dame’s Sam Hartman, and Washington’s Michael Penix Jr. Nix and Penix have the potential to break into the first round and if medical checks pan out positively, Penix could be a serious consideration for the Broncos.
